I love the McFarlane Dragons line. I have a pretty large collection of those in storage. I tried bringing them out, but there's no space. McFarlane is so detailed, but their stuff doesn't age well. Parts easily break or become warped. Mixed bag, since they're so cheap.

Actually, I've really big a big fan of the First4Figures line of gaming statues. It started out with the Fierce Deity Link, but the first one I was able to get was the Skull Kid. And I gotta say, this is still a favorite.

First4Figures makes some nice stuff. I think they did the Metroid ones I saw awhile back too that looked real nice. I might've gotten a Samus Aran if I was there when they came out.

As far as my non-kaiju stuff, I'd only gotten into Sideshow's polystone TMNT statues: http://i79.photobucket.com/albums/j143/ ... C03357.jpg

I wish there was more high-end Godzilla stuff like this. The price you pay for an X-Plus piece of frickin' vinyl, you can get an entire polystone statue at sideshow for the same price.
